As a Long-Term Care Division Sales Manager on the Renal Team in Dallas TX, you'll play a pivotal role in channeling our scientific capabilities to make a positive impact on changing patients' lives.AstraZeneca's strategy in Renal focuses on ways to reduce morbidity, mortality, and organ damage by addressing multiple risk factors related to chronic kidney disease. This patient-centric approach is reinforced by science-led life-cycle management programs and technologies, including early research into regenerative methods.What you'll do

  • You will provide inspirational leadership and strategic direction to a team of Renal Long-Term Care Sales Specialists in order to achieve performance objectives. This will be accomplished by meeting field day requirements and through effective coaching, mentoring, and utilization of resources aligned with the organizational vision.
  • By developing people, you will drive business by observing your sales specialists' interactions with key customers, providing him/her with individual coaching and feedback to develop them for success in current role and for future growth.
  • As a role model and liaison, you will inspire commitment, trust, collaboration, and motivation for the shared vision by facilitating team communication, morale, and effectiveness within your own work unit and/or cross functional teams.
  • You will actively seek to discover and meet the needs of internal and external customers by building relationships, identifying strategic business opportunities and delivering innovative solutions to key LTC HCPs, targeted accounts, and regional pharmacies.
  • You will manage multiple priorities and resources related to individual and group efforts. Take responsibility for redirecting efforts as needed to deliver high productivity and quality of work from self and others.
  • You will be asked to demonstrate strong business ethics, understand basic business principles, and interpret resources available to make sound business decision to help achieve standards of business excellence.
Essential Requirements
  • Bachelor's Degree (life science discipline is a plus)
  • 4+ years of experience with consistent success in pharmaceutical sales or healthcare sales
  • At least 3 years of District Sales Manager experience in the pharmaceutical/biotechnology industry
  • More than 3 years of experience selling LTC products to physicians
  • More than 3 years of experience selling to LTC accounts
  • Demonstrated leadership capabilities, financial management, and written as well as oral communications skills
  • Ability to adapt and thrive in a newly defined role
  • A valid driver's license and safe driving record
  • Must reside within the boundaries of the Division (Define Geography)
Desirable Requirements
  • 3+ years of leading an LTC team as a DSM
  • More than 3 years of experience selling renal products
  • Preference for candidate to live within market, which includes the following US States: (Fort Worth TX, Houston TX, Austin TX, San Antonio TX, Oklahoma City OK, Tulsa OK, Fayetteville AR, Little Rock AR, Memphis TN, Shreveport LA, Kansas City KS, St. Louis MO & Springfield IL)
  • Exposure and/or experience in other functional areas of the business (e.g. Sales Training, Customer Solutions, Sales Operations, Managed Care and Marketing)
